You can have Christmas Ginger biscuits using 8 ingredients and 12 steps. Here is how you cook it.
Ingredients of Christmas Ginger biscuits
- Prepare 100 grams of butter cubed.
- You need 1 1/2 tbsp of ground ginger.
- Prepare 1 knob of fresh ginger finely grated.
- It's 100 grams of golden syrup.
- Prepare 1 of egg yolk whisked.
- Prepare 250 grams of self raising flour.
- Prepare 1 tsp of bicarbonate of soda.
- You need 75 grams of soft brown sugar.

Christmas Ginger biscuits step by step
- Set the oven temperature to 170 degrees. Cube the butter, throw it in a saucepan. Next put in the sugar..
- Grate the fresh ginger, add that to the pan and then the golden syrup..
- Turn on the heat to a medium setting so it softens and melts the mixture..
- Meanwhile in bowl, add the ground ginger, flour and bicarbonate..
- In a separate bowl, add the egg yolk and whisk it with a fork..
- Add the egg to the flour and mix well..
- Once the syrup mixture is melted, stir and leave to cook, to speed up the process, you can put the pan in cold sink of water..
- Once it’s cooked slowly add it to the flour..
- Keep stirring until smooth..
- Line a large baking tray with baking paper. I used a tablespoon measure to scoop out equal quantities of the mixture! It makes approximately 20 biscuits. Roll them into a ball and place on to the baking tray..
- Bake them in the oven for 8 to 10 minutes..
- Allow them to cool and serve !.
